Cost of Living in Mexicali - Frequently Asked Questions
How does affordability compare for travelers, expats, and digital nomads in this city?
Cost of Living in Mexicali, Mexico varies by choices, but many travelers and expats find it approachable compared with larger Mexican cities and U.S. border hubs. You’ll notice value in local food, public transport, and long-stay lodging when you opt for neighborhoods a short ride from the center. The mix of affordable taquerias, markets, and mid-range rentals helps you balance comfort with flexibility. Because Mexicali sits near the U.S. border, some goods may be priced with cross-border demand, but you can still keep a crisp daily budget by cooking at home and using public transit. Tip: Start with a week in the Centro to assess pace, then widen your search.
What does daily life look like in terms of housing search, food options, and getting around?
Daily life in Mexicali blends practical logistics with a relaxed pace. For housing, look beyond flashy areas and consider Centro or newer residential belts within a short drive of services; lease terms are often flexible for longer stays. Food options range from affordable street eats to open-air markets with fresh produce and bread; many nomads enjoy cooking most evenings to stretch a budget. Transport is straightforward: reliable bus routes, ride-hailing, and walkable downtown cores. For work, you’ll find coworking spaces and cafés with dependable wifi, though power outages are rare but possible in peak heat. Mexicali, Mexico living cost varies by season and neighborhood. Tip: map a few nearby grocery spots and daily commute times before choosing a base.
What factors influence overall quality of life and budgeting, and how can you tailor your approach to seasons and neighborhoods?
Quality of life in Mexicali hinges on balance – comfort, access to amenities, and pace. A practical budgeting framework helps: prioritize essential utilities, groceries, and local services; set a flexible dining and entertainment allowance. Seasonality matters: summers demand cooling strategies and hydration, while milder winters open more outdoor activities and lower energy use. Neighborhood fit matters too: Centro offers walkability and services; more residential belts provide quieter mornings and longer commutes to key spots. Build a base with a few long-running errands in mind, then explore weekend markets for seasonal produce and social scenes. Tip: test two different areas during a week to sense rhythm and safety.
